Programatori pentru avr, avr, programare

Sunt adesea întrebat cum să bliț AVR-ki, deci aici am decis să pun link-uri către programatori.

[Programatori AVR cu interfață USB]

Programatori pentru avr, avr, programare

AVR-Doper. Programatorul care acceptă protocolul STK500 (acest lucru înseamnă că este compatibil cu un set mare de instrumente pentru programare, inclusiv Studio AVR și AVRDUDE), poate menține un -Programarea ISP consistentă, precum și de înaltă tensiune de programare HVSP. Ea sews aproape toate cunoscute chips-uri AVR. Puteți face singur, circuitul nu este foarte complicat, sunt gata făcute cod sursă de firmware este complet deschis. Pentru a lucra sub Windows nevoie de un conducător auto, care este inclus cu codul sursă.







Programatori pentru avr, avr, programare

AVRISP-MkII. Clona programului programator Atmel cu același nume susține, de asemenea, protocolul STK500. Nu HVSP, dar cu excepția ISP, suportă interfețele TPI și PDI. astfel încât să poată bloca și o serie mai modernă de microcontrolere XMEGA. Ca și AVR-Doper, este susținut de multe programe populare. Schema este foarte simplă, ciine întregul sortiment de AVR (plus XMEGA), deci acest programator este un bun candidat pentru o producție sau cumpărare independentă. Schema este simplă, codul sursă este deschis, poate fi compilat pentru aproape orice chip AVR cu o interfață USB hardware. Pentru a lucra în Windows, aveți nevoie de un driver, care este inclus împreună cu codul sursă. Ca programator de utilități este cel mai bine să utilizați AVR Studio versiunea 4.19.

Programatori pentru avr, avr, programare

mkII-slim. O altă clonă a aceluiași programator AVRISP-mkII, pentru care este proiectată o placă de circuite imprimate, astfel încât să poată fi asamblată acasă. Acest programator are un stabilizator încorporat la 3.3V și permite unui jumper să comute tensiunea cipului programabil - 3.3V sau 5V.

Programatori pentru avr, avr, programare

AVR Dragon. Un programator popular, nu foarte scump și debuggerul Atmel în circuit, clonele sale pot fi găsite pe eBay la prețuri în jur de 50 $. Acesta susține AVR Studio, IAR Embedded Workbench și multe alte medii de programare populare. Puteți chiar să faceți singur (nu există cod sursă, nu există nici o schemă și este complicat, doar protocolul STK500 este deschis), dar dacă aveți bani și dorința de a vă implica serios în programare, atunci trebuie să cumpărați AVR Dragon. Pentru a lucra în Windows, aveți nevoie de un driver care este instalat cu AVR Studio.

Programatori pentru avr, avr, programare

Atmel AVR JTAGICE mkII. "Artilerie grea" pentru programarea și depanarea AVR. Și programator ISP și emulator în circuit (JTAG, debugWIRE) într-o singură sticlă. Am folosit acest lucru de foarte mult timp și sunt foarte fericit. Funcționează prin COM port și USB. Standardul de facto (este înțeles chiar și de avrdude) este bun pentru toată lumea, cu excepția prețului. Programe cu care funcționează - AVR Studio, program regulat pentru console, avrdude. Sunt acceptate interfețele de depanare DebugWire și JTAG. întreaga gamă de AVR-uri este programată, dar nu există suport pentru programarea HVSP de înaltă tensiune. Soluție scumpă, recomandați-vă că este dificil să cumpărați, dar este ireal să repetați. Pentru a lucra în Windows, aveți nevoie de un driver care este instalat cu AVR Studio.

Programatori pentru avr, avr, programare






Programatori pentru avr, avr, programare

USBtinyISP. Proiect complet open source. Are 2 conectori ISP - 6 pini și 10 pini. Cipul ATtiny2313-20P este utilizat, circuitul este foarte simplu.

Programatori pentru avr, avr, programare

USB AVR programator. Nu este scris că clona AVR910, dar foarte asemănătoare cu aceasta. Fabricat pe FT232BM și ATtiny2313. Un proiect complet deschis - cu o schemă și un cod sursă.

Programatori pentru avr, avr, programare

vusbtiny. Probabil cel mai mic programator ISP din lume cu o interfață USB, și cel mai simplu.

[Alți programatori AVR conectați prin COM și LPT]

Acești programatori nu sunt atât de relevanți astăzi, deoarece nu puteți vedea porturile COM și LPT în calculatoare, în special laptop-uri.

Programatori pentru avr, avr, programare

STK500. Dezvoltarea Atmel (ATSTK500). Conectat prin COM-port, sprijină programarea ISP și HVSP. instrument foarte gravă, dar astăzi este deja depășită. Schema și protocolul sunt deschise, dar nu există nici firmware-sursă (firmware furnizat cu versiunea AVR Studio 4.11 construi 401 și mai târziu, este în Atmel \ Instrumente AVR Fișier \ STK500 \ STK500.ebn - poate fi direct în flash sau At90s8535 Mega8535 programator ca AVR910) . Acesta a declarat că sews toate jetoanele Atmel în DIP-carcasă care susține programarea paralelă. Se conectează la calculator prin COM-port, lucrează cu AVR Studio, acceptă depanare. Există, de asemenea, clonează STK500 (unele conectat la USB, deoarece acestea au o punte USB-COM). Există, de asemenea, proiecte non-profit, de exemplu HVProg.

Programatori pentru avr, avr, programare

Programatori pentru avr, avr, programare

Programatori pentru avr, avr, programare

Programatori pentru avr, avr, programare

ChipProg +. De asemenea, un programator universal de la Fiton. Versiune mai modernă, există variante cu conexiune la LPT și USB. Programul de control rulează sub Windows. În opinia mea, programul de management este umed, iar funcționalitatea și confortul sunt inferioare coajelor preistorice ale PicProg +, care au lucrat pe MS-DOS. Din păcate, dezvoltatorii nu le pasă de utilizatorii programatorului și nu acordă atenție cererilor de adăugare de suport pentru cipurile noi. Prin urmare, este mai bine să nu cumpărați acest programator.

Programatori pentru avr, avr, programare

PonyProg. Un programator ISP foarte popular și de înaltă calitate cu circuit deschis. Este conectat prin COM și USB prin intermediul unui adaptor.

Programatori pentru avr, avr, programare

Uniprof. Programatorul "pe cabluri", foarte simplu, conectabil la COM sau LPT. Nu există nici un circuit ca atare, este atât de simplu. Funcționează numai cu programul "său", codul sursă care nu.

Programatori pentru avr, avr, programare

AVReAl. utilitar software care ruleaza pe Windows, Linux si FreeBSD. Programul poate fi folosit cu scopuri comerciale sau necomerciale, dar textele sale sunt închise, adică. E. Este gratuit (freeware), dar nu este liber (software gratuit). Utilitarul acceptă unul dintre soiurile de scheme „pe postărilor,“ dar o mai avansate - pot fi utilizate nu numai LPT-adaptoare, dar adaptoarele și USB-a făcut pe chips-uri baza de FT2232C, FT2232L, FT2232D, FT2232H, FT4232H, FT232H. Pentru mai multe informații googled cuvânt AVReAL.

programator compatibil AVR910. AVR910 bun pentru că a sprijinit avrdude, Atmel AVR Studio și CodeVision, un circuit de protocol și firmware cod sursă deschisă. Bad, deoarece programator proiectat inițial pentru COM-port, astfel încât cernerii la USB nevoie de un tip FT232 cip, sau în căutarea pentru schema și bazată pe firmware biblioteca V-USB (fosta AVR-USB). clone AVR910 crescut foarte mult. Iată câteva link-uri:

STK200 + / 300 sunt programatori compatibili [2]. Permiteți o schemă foarte simplă de asamblare a unui programator conectat prin portul LPT. Programatorul Kanda Systems STK200 / STK300 este susținut de mai multe module pentru programare: IC-Prog, PonyProg, UniProf, CodeVisionAVR C Compiler.

Olimex. Programatoarele bune și necostisitoare, compacte și debuggerii AVR (cu o conexiune USB) sunt oferite de Olimex [1]. Compania este fiabilă și o trimite rapid Rusiei.







Trimiteți-le prietenilor: